Agent metrics
The Instana host agent collects and reports various metrics about its own performance, configuration, and operational status.
Viewing agent metrics
The Instana agent monitors itself and provides detailed information about its composition, management capabilities, resource consumption, and operational health.You can view these metrics in the agent dashboard to understand agent behavior, troubleshoot issues, and optimize performance.To view agent metrics, complete the following steps:

Agent composition metrics
The following metrics provide information about the agent's composition and configuration:
| Metric | Description |
|---|---|
| Composition | |
| Sensors version | Sensors version (called "agent version" before release 321) of the Instana agent currently running. |
| Agent version | Agent version (called "agent boot version" before release 321) of the bootstrap component that is used when the agent was started. |
| Origin | Installation method used to deploy the Instana agent. |
| Update mode | Update strategy configured for the Instana agent. |
| Log level | Logging level configured for the Instana agent. |
| Mode | Operating mode of the Instana agent. |
| Java runtime | Type of Java runtime used by the Instana agent. |
| Java version | Version of the Java runtime used by the Instana agent. |
| User | Operating system user that is running the Instana agent process. |
| Started at | Date and time when the Instana agent was started. |
Agent management metrics
The following metrics relate to agent management operations and actions:
| Metric | Description |
|---|---|
| Management1 | |
| Change agent mode | Change the mode of the Instana agent: APM, Off, Infrastructure, or AWS |
| Change log level | Change the logging level of the Instana agent |
| Update agent | Update the Instana agent to the latest available version |
| Reset agent | Triggers an internal restart of the Instana agent |
| Reboot agent | Restart the Instana agent process |
| Information | |
| Sensor information | Displays the list and status of sensors currently active in the Instana agent |
| Download logs1 | Downloads the log files that are generated by the Instana agent. |
| Configuration management | |
| Initialize | Triggers the initialization of the Git-based configuration management |
| Support1 | |
| Collect support information | Generates a support package that contain agent state, configuration, logs, and sensor information for troubleshooting purposes. |
| Profile agent | Instana agent self-profiling feature for analyzing agent performance metrics (feature not available). |
Agent monitoring metrics
The following metrics provide real-time monitoring information about the agent's performance and health:
| Metric | Description |
|---|---|
| Monitoring issues | |
| On | Entity or component where the issue occurred |
| Code | Identifier representing the type of issue detected |
| Description | Brief summary of the issue |
| More information | Documentation links to additional technical details and remediation information |
| CPU load | |
| Load | Percentage of CPU resources used by the Instana agent JVM process |
| JVM memory | |
| Heap | Heap memory that is allocated for the Instana agent JVM |
| Direct buffer | Native memory that is allocated outside the JVM heap by the Instana agent |
| Off heap | Auxiliary JVM memory areas that are used for class metadata and thread management |
| Garbage collection2 | |
| MarkSweepCompact time | Time spent on garbage collection in the old (tenured) generation |
| Copy time | Time spent on garbage collection in the young generation during copy operations |
| MarkSweepCompact invocations | Number of garbage collection executions in the old (tenured) generation. |
| Copy invocations | Number of garbage collection executions in the young generation. |
| Network | |
| Received | Amount of data received by the agent from the backend. |
| Sent | Amount of data that is sent from the agent to the backend. |
| Discovery | |
| Discovery time | Time required by the Instana agent to scan and identify processes and services on the host |
| Discovery count | Number of available discovery services during a single discovery cycle |
| Sensors | |
| Sense time | Time the agent spends on collecting sensor metrics |
| Sensor count | Current number of active sensor instances |
| Log output1 | |
| Live log view | Real-time view of agent logs |
